17 février , 2025

Le modèle OSI : un cadre essentiel pour la mise en réseau des systèmes informatiques

À la rédaction : Vincent

Grand amateur de technologies numériques et plus particulièrement de l'univers Apple. Je rédige également des articles d'actualités sur le monde de l'entreprise ainsi que la Finance.

Maîtriser le clavier Mac

Dans le secteur de l’informatique et des réseaux, le modèle d’interconnexion de systèmes ouverts (OSI) tient une place centrale. Ce cadre conceptuel est destiné à standardiser les communications entre différents systèmes informatiques, afin de garantir une interopérabilité maximale.

Nous vous proposons un point détaillé sur les principales caractéristiques du modèle OSI, ses avantages, ainsi que les sept couches qui le composent.

Introduction au modèle OSI

Le modèle OSI (Open Systems Interconnection) est une norme développée par l’Organisation internationale de normalisation (ISO) dans les années 1980. Son objectif principal est de permettre aux divers produits de communication numérique et logiciels informatiques de fonctionner ensemble, même s’ils proviennent de différents fabricants. En décomposant la communication réseau en sept couches distinctes, le modèle OSI facilite non seulement la compréhension des processus complexes impliqués, mais aussi la conception et le dépannage des réseaux reliant les parcs informatiques.

L’importance du modèle OSI

L’un des principaux avantages du modèle OSI réside dans sa capacité à définir des terminologies et des cadres communs utilisés dans toute discussion sur les réseaux. Cette normalisation aide les développeurs et les fournisseurs à s’assurer que leurs produits sont compatibles, facilitant ainsi l’interopérabilité. De plus, le modèle OSI offre une architecture de sécurité compréhensible, ce qui permet une meilleure protection contre les menaces diverses. Il se distingue également par sa flexibilité, permettant aux ingénieurs de modéliser et de décomposer des architectures réseau complexes sans connaissance préalable du système.

Détails des sept couches du modèle OSI

Chaque couche du modèle OSI a une fonction spécifique et interagit avec les couches directement adjacentes pour assurer un flux de communication continu. Voici une description détaillée de chaque couche :

Couche 1 : La couche physique

La couche physique concerne les aspects matériels de la connexion réseau. Elle définit les caractéristiques électriques et physiques des dispositifs, comme les types de câbles utilisés (cuivre, fibre optique), les connecteurs, les niveaux de tension, etc. Cette couche inclut aussi des standards pour diverses technologies telles que Bluetooth et NFC, garantissant ainsi la transmission des données via différents canaux.

Couche 2 : La couche de liaison de données

Cette couche assure la livraison fiable des données en établissant une liaison directe entre deux nœuds adjacents. Elle gère les erreurs de transmission, contrôle le flux des données et organise les trames ou paquets transmis sur le réseau. Des technologies comme Ethernet fonctionnent principalement au niveau de cette couche pour établir des connexions réseau locales.

Couche 3 : La couche réseau

La couche réseau prend en charge l’adressage et le routage des données sur plusieurs nœuds. Des protocoles essentiels comme IPv4 et IPv6 permettent de diriger les paquets de données vers leur destination à travers différents réseaux et sous-réseaux. Elle est essentielle pour les opérations de routage avancé et pour établir des chemins optimisés afin d’éviter les congestions et les retards inutiles.

Couche 4 : La couche de transport

Pour assurer une communication fiable et ordonnée, la couche de transport segmente les données en morceaux plus petits, les reconstitue et garantit leur intégrité. Les protocoles TCP et UDP opèrent à ce niveau pour offrir soit des transmissions robustes sans perte de données, soit des transmissions rapides mais potentiellement moins fiables.

  • TCP : Utilisé pour les situations où chaque fragment de donnée doit être reçu correctement avant la transmission suivante.
  • UDP : Employé pour des applications nécessitant des transferts rapides, même si certaines données peuvent être perdues, comme le streaming vidéo ou audio.

Couche 5 : La couche session

La couche session gère les sessions de communication entre appareils. Elle établit, maintient et termine les sessions, veillant à ce qu’elles restent ouvertes assez longtemps pour transférer les données nécessaires puis les ferme dès que c’est fait. Un bon exemple serait une session FTP utilisée pour télécharger de gros fichiers ; cette couche garantit que toutes les parties du fichier sont transmises correctement et renvoie celles manquantes en cas de problème.

Couche 6 : La couche de présentation

La couche de présentation traduit les données entre le format utilisé par l’application et celui utilisé sur le réseau. C’est ici que se font les opérations de cryptage/décryptage, de compression/décompression et de traduction de formats de données. Par exemple, elle pourrait convertir des données XML en un format binaire approprié pour la transmission réseau et revenir à XML si elles arrivent à destination.

Couche 7 : La couche application

Enfin, la couche application est celle la plus proche de l’utilisateur final. Elle fournit des services réseau directs tels que le transfert de courrier électronique, le partage de fichiers et l’affichage web. Gmail ou Outlook, servant à envoyer et recevoir des e-mails, fonctionnent à cette couche. Cette couche utilise les services des autres couches pour réaliser une communication complète et simplifiée tout en cachant les détails complexes du réseau à l’utilisateur.

Les avantages et les inconvénients du modèle OSI

Les avantages

  • Séparation claire des fonctions : Chaque couche a une tâche spécifique, ce qui rend le modèle plus facile à comprendre et à enseigner.
  • Interopérabilité : Grâce aux normes universelles, différentes implémentations peuvent travailler ensemble de manière fluide.
  • Modularité : En raison de sa nature segmentée, il est possible de remplacer ou de mettre à jour une couche sans affecter les autres couches.

Les inconvénients

  • Complexité : La division en sept couches peut sembler excessive pour certaines applications simples, ce qui complique parfois sa mise en œuvre initiale.
  • Cohérence de protocole : Certaines couches offrent des fonctions similaires comme le contrôle d’erreurs, ce qui peut causer des redondances.
  • Performance : Dans ses premières versions, le modèle était critiqué pour son inefficacité due à la division trop fine des tâches.

Pour résumer, le modèle OSI est une référence essentielle dans le domaine des réseaux et des télécommunications. Son approche en couches permet une séparation des tâches facilitant la conception, la maintenance et l’évolution des infrastructures réseau. Bien que parfois jugé trop théorique ou complexe, il sert encore aujourd’hui de cadre pour la plupart des communications réseau et inspire l’architecture des protocoles modernes. Comprendre ses principes fondamentaux permet aux ingénieurs et aux techniciens de mieux appréhender les problématiques de connectivité, de sécurité et d’interopérabilité. Son rôle dans l’enseignement et la formation reste incontournable, garantissant que les nouvelles générations de professionnels disposent des connaissances nécessaires pour relever les défis des réseaux de demain.

À propos de l'auteur : Vincent

Grand amateur de technologies numériques et plus particulièrement de l'univers Apple. Je rédige également des articles d'actualités sur le monde de l'entreprise ainsi que la Finance.

Articles associés

Maîtriser le clavier Mac

Aller en haut